Introduction : Enabling fictions -- The elegiac mode : rhetoric and poetics in the 1940s -- "The darkness surrounds us" : participation and reflection among the Beat writers -- "Spotting that design" : incarnation and interpretation in Gary Snyder and Philip Whalen -- "Cave of resemblances, cave of rimes" : tradition and repetition in Robert Duncan -- "The city redefined" : community and dialogue in Jack Spicer -- Appropriations : women and the San Francisco Renaissance -- Approaching the fin de siècle.
